      Hello, I will answer your question, and after that you can think for yourself, I visited Dili last October for 2 weeks. and living in a country definitely has its ups and downs, right?
      --I like the nature of Dili, the beaches are really beautiful, the local people are friendly and the country hasn't developed much.
      --Hotels in Dili cannot be booked via OTA (online travel agent). You can only make a reservation via their website (if there is a website), and payment can only be done directly at check-in.
      --Dili is a country that is still traditional, while other countries already have technology/e-commerce that is capable of making transactions easier and easier to order something, Dili doesn't have that, there is only 1 e-commerce called Halo Dili, even though it's not complete, delivery takes 1 hours or even later, you only order 1 portion of food even though it is close to where you live😁
      --if you want fast transportation, it's still hard to get because their only transportation is taxi (they will add more passengers if the passengers route is the same as yours), and there are microbuses (this is the same system like taxi, but with more passengers. they will stop to get passengers and drop them off at their respective destinations if you are in a hurry this is not an alternative) so it is better to rent a motorbike/car even if it is expensive at least it is a little comfortable.
      --Dili is really expensive, even if you save money it won't seem like enough lol.
      -- Mastercard cannot be accessed so you have to bring lots of cash, as well as applications like Disney+ or HBO GO not available in Timor Leste, Netflix is available but if your signal is good you're lucky.

    Tetun is similar to Indonesian languages from the surrounding area, West Timor and East Nusa Tenggara, mixed with Portuguese as you said but it's not related to Bahasa Indonesia. Bahasa Indonesia is actually Malay, Malay grew to prominance in the region with the Muslim Malaccan Sultanate. The Dutch decided to establish it as the national language of Indonesia, instead of Dutch because it had already been a language of trade and prestige in the region even before the Dutch colonial era. One decision otherwise and the entire country of Indonesia right now would be speaking Dutch as the national language!

    After Timor Leste (Timor Timur/East Timor) got their independence from Indonesia. We all happy here (especially traders and businessmen) 😁 because they use US Dollar as National Currency. So we can export our product to TL and earn a lot of money. Thats why there are many Indonesian and Chinese in Dili. And majority of staple food needs in TL are supplied from Indonesia. Such as cooking oil, Gasoline, sugar, snack, noodles, soap, everything. Also Telkomcel the best provider in TL owned by Indonesian national company. And also in Finance sector Indonesia take a huge role in TL. Many Indonensian state owned company playing huge role in TL. Yeah as you know, we Indonesia have a long history with TL. this is not an obstacle for us to work together and develop together. And now, Indonesia become a main sponsor for TL to join ASEAN.
